cache.h: create 'index_name_pos_sparse()'
Add 'index_name_pos_sparse()', which behaves the same as 'index_name_pos()', except that it does not expand a sparse index to search for an entry inside a sparse directory. 'index_entry_exists()' was originally implemented in 20ec2d034c (reset: make sparse-aware (except --mixed), 2021-11-29) as an alternative to 'index_name_pos()' to allow callers to search for an index entry without expanding a sparse index. However, that particular use case only required knowing whether the requested entry existed, so 'index_entry_exists()' does not return the index positioning information provided by 'index_name_pos()'. This patch implements 'index_name_pos_sparse()' to accommodate callers that need the positioning information of 'index_name_pos()', but do not want to expand the index.
